"The Last Of The Dogmen" (1995)

An engaging fictional tale about a tracker in a remote part of Montana seeking to apprehend three escaped convicts. In the chase, the convicts are mysteriously attacked and presumed murdered by some one or some thing. Having seen something he wasn't sure of, he heads back to town on a very different mission. To find out who or what is in there.

With the reluctant help of an anthropologist, together they go back into the mountains and forest looking for the possibility of an undiscovered Cheyenne tribe which has somehow evaded white civilization into the late 20th century.

And they find them. A film with a happy ending to boot! :cool:

"Red Lights" - 2011

A film about two PhD's (Sigourney Weaver & Cillian Murphy) who teach debunking psychics at a university. When class isn't going, they're out debunking new cases. Suddenly they hear about a well-known psychic (Robert DeNiro) who has come out of retirement. One of the PhD's becomes obsessed with proving to the world that this guy is a fraud.

With an ending I didn't see coming. Caught this one on Tubi.
